Dairy Forward Pricing Program Reupped Through 2028 for Stability

Published Date: 4/23/2025

Rule

Summary

The Dairy Forward Pricing Program is back in action! Dairy handlers can now make new contracts until September 30, 2025, helping them lock in prices and plan ahead. Any deals made by then will last until September 30, 2028, giving everyone more time and stability in the dairy market.

Dairy handlers can enter new contracts

If you are a dairy handler, you can enter new Dairy Forward Pricing Program contracts until September 30, 2025. Establishing new contracts had been prohibited after the program expired on September 30, 2024, but the program is now reauthorized through September 30, 2025.

Forward contracts expire September 30, 2028

Any Dairy Forward Pricing Program contract entered before September 30, 2025 will have an expiration date of September 30, 2028. This sets a fixed end date for contracts made during the reauthorization window.
